Unmasking the Dangers: A Guide to Avoiding Locksmith Scams in Upstate NY
Navigating the world of locksmith services can be a real headache, especially when you're facing emergencies. Unfortunately, Upstate NY is no stranger to dodgy locksmiths who prey on vulnerable homeowners and businesses. To protect yourself from falling victim, it's crucial to be aware of common schemes used by these con artists.
- Always research potential locksmiths thoroughly. Check online reviews, request referrals from trusted sources, and verify their credentials with the state.
- Receive a written estimate before any work is done. This will help you avoid unexpected charges.
- Exercise caution of locksmiths who show up unexpectedly or coerce you into making a quick decision.
- Refrain from opening your door to anyone claiming to be a locksmith without first verifying their identity and credentials.
By following these simple guidelines, you can protect yourself and your property from dangerous locksmith frauds in Upstate NY.
